Facebook has announced that it will hire 3,000 people to help monitor crime implicated videos on the social-media platform. CEO Mark Zuckerberg announced that the new hires become a key part of a plan to review “millions of reports we get every week”, and to ultimately “build a safe community” online and beyond.
